Vande Mataram Played Before IND-AFG T20I; First For Indian Sport At International Level

During the India-Afghanistan T20I match, the national song 'Vande Mataram' was played in its entirety for the first time in the history of Indian sports at the international level. This historic moment took place at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in Delhi, marking a significant milestone for the country's sporting events.
